Bushkill Falls, often referred to as the 'Niagara of Pennsylvania,' is a breathtaking natural attraction that offers visitors stunning waterfalls, scenic hiking trails, and an immersive outdoor experience. Nestled in the Pocono Mountains, this enchanting location is perfect for nature lovers, families, and adventure seekers alike, presenting a unique opportunity to explore the beauty of Pennsylvania's landscapes.

Getting There
-
Car
To reach Bushkill Falls by car from anywhere in Lower Susquehanna Valley, head north on Route 15 or I-83 towards Harrisburg. Merge onto I-78 E and continue for about 55 miles. Take the exit for US-209 N towards Stroudsburg. Follow US-209 N for approximately 22 miles until you reach the intersection with PA-739. Turn left onto PA-739 N and continue for about 7 miles. Then, turn right onto Bushkill Falls Trail and follow the signs to the parking area. Please note that there may be a parking fee of around $10.
-
Public Transportation
If using public transportation, take a bus from Harrisburg to East Stroudsburg. From East Stroudsburg, you may need to take a taxi or rideshare service to reach Bushkill Falls, as there are no direct public transport links. The taxi ride will take around 20-30 minutes and cost approximately $30-$40. Ensure you check the bus schedules in advance, as they may vary, and plan your return accordingly.
-
Ride-sharing
If you prefer not to drive, consider using a ride-sharing service like Uber or Lyft. Simply enter 'Bushkill Falls, 138 Bushkill Falls Trail, Bushkill, PA 18324' as your destination in the app. The cost will depend on your starting location but expect to pay between $30-$50 from major towns in Lower Susquehanna Valley.
